#3b171d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b171d is composed of 23.1% red, 9%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61% magenta, 50.8%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 350 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 16.1%. #3b171d color hex could be obtained by blending #762e3a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#3b171d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#faf3f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b171d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2b2728 is the less saturated color, while #51010e is the most saturated one.
